Assembly Biosciences, Inc. is a clinical-stage biotechnology company in the United States. The company is headquartered in South San Francisco, California.

Merck & Company Inc

HEALTHCARE · DRUG MANUFACTURERS - GENERAL · USA

Merck & Co. is an American multinational pharmaceutical company headquartered in Kenilworth, New Jersey. It is named after the Merck family, which set up Merck Group in Germany in 1668.
